The Agafay Desert is not a “sand desert” like Merzouga or Zagora, but a stony, barren landscape shaped by time and wind. Despite its rocky terrain, it has a mesmerizing beauty — especially at sunrise and sunset, when the light transforms the hills into waves of gold and bronze.
Its location makes it ideal for visitors who want a desert experience without the long journey to the Sahara.
For centuries, the Agafay region was used by nomadic tribes and caravans passing between Marrakech and the Atlas Mountains. Though less famous than the Sahara, it has always held cultural significance as a place of resilience, survival, and quiet beauty.

Despite its arid appearance, Agafay hides a secret: the Oasis of Agafay, a green patch with olive and eucalyptus trees, where natural springs sustain small farms. It offers a refreshing contrast to the desert around it.
Distance: 30–40 minutes (about 30 km) southwest of Marrakech.
Best Time to Visit: Autumn and spring, when the weather is mild. Summer can be very hot, while winter nights are cold.
What to Bring: Sunglasses, sunscreen, comfortable shoes, and a jacket for cooler evenings.
Tours: Half-day or full-day tours available; many include dinner and entertainment in a desert camp.
